What is Primobolan?
Primobolan, also known as Methenolone, is a synthetic AAS that was first developed in the 1960s. It is available in both oral and injectable forms, with the injectable form being the most commonly used by athletes. Primobolan is known for its anabolic properties, which means it promotes muscle growth and strength, making it a popular choice among bodybuilders and athletes.
Primobolan is also considered a relatively mild steroid, with lower androgenic effects compared to other AAS. This makes it a preferred choice for female athletes, as it is less likely to cause virilization (development of male characteristics) in women.

Pharmacokinetics and Pharmacodynamics of Primobolan
To understand the importance of correct dosage in Primobolan injection, it is essential to have a basic understanding of its pharmacokinetics and pharmacodynamics. Pharmacokinetics refers to how a medication is absorbed, distributed, metabolized, and eliminated by the body, while pharmacodynamics refers to how the medication affects the body.
Primobolan has a half-life of approximately 10 days, which means it takes 10 days for half of the medication to be eliminated from the body. This is relatively long compared to other AAS, which have shorter half-lives. This is why Primobolan is typically injected once a week, as it maintains stable levels in the body.
When injected, Primobolan is rapidly absorbed into the bloodstream and binds to androgen receptors in various tissues, including muscle tissue. This binding triggers a cascade of events that ultimately leads to increased protein synthesis, which is essential for muscle growth and repair.
